幾類常見的測試工程師面試題
過去在傳統的軟體行業,基本上每個公司都會設有軟體測試工程師這一崗位,主要負責軟體上架或更新前的測試,保證軟體質量。而現在除軟體類公司外,網站、小程式等網際網路公司也會設有測試工程師崗,來負責保證公司產品的質量,整個行業對於測試工程師的需求量還是比較大的。那麼對於求職者而言,有哪幾類常見的測試工程師面試題,是可以提前準備好回答的呢?
有標準答案的面試問題
無論在哪一類公司,測試工程師的部分工作內容基本是一致的,因此也會有一些不論去什麼公司面試都可能會遇到的通用面試問題,這類問題基本都有較為標準的答案,只要提前把答案背出來即可。
例:請描述一下自動化測試流程?
答:編寫自動化測試計劃→設計自動化測試用例→編寫自動化測試框架和指令碼→除錯並維護指令碼→無人值守測試→後期指令碼維護。
能力介紹類面試問題
在面試過程中,面試官通常會結合本公司的業務對於求職者有一些針對性的提問,比如你會XX嗎?XX問題你會如何解決等等,這類問題除了要回答問題本身外,最好要結合自己之前的工作經驗展開描述,進而論證自己的能力水平。
例:你會封裝自動化測試框架嗎?
答:封裝自動化測試框架對我來說並不難。自動化框架主要的核心框架就是分層+PO模式,分別為:基礎封裝層BasePage,PO頁面物件層,TestCase測試用例層。然後再加上日誌處理模組,ini配置檔案讀取模組,unittest+ddt資料驅動模組,jenkins持續整合模式組成。我在進行相關操作時,通常會從XX下手,關注以下幾個注意點,進而保證完美完成工作。
場景類面試問題
具體產品不同的公司,其測試工程師具體的工作內容也是有所差異的,因此在面試過程中,求職者也很可能會遇到更有針對性的問題。這個時候在準備好基本的回答思路後,最好提前瞭解該公司的產品及生產情況,然後結合具體場景進行作答。例:
問:你覺得自動化測試的價值在哪裡?如何說服公司高層做自動化測試?
答:自動化測試一般是對穩定下來的功能進行自動化,比如公司中的XX測試部分就可以引用自動化,能夠保證不會因為產品的更新導致之前穩定下來的功能出現BUG。應用自動化測試之後,能代替大量繁瑣的迴歸測試工作,比如XX工作內容,把本公司的業務測試人員解放出來後,可以使其把精力集中在複雜的業務功能模組上,比如XX業務等。
測試工程師是一個對專業性要求較高的崗位,因此公司在面試過程中,專業性的面試問題也會比較多。求職者在準備測試工程師面試時,除了要提前瞭解通用面試問題的答案外,也一定要去了解自己所要面試的公司的主營業務是什麼,有哪些產品,對於測試工程師的工作要求是怎樣的,這樣才能更加精準地做好面試準備。
-
公務員考試面試考察什麼
公務員考試面試一般是結構化面試,是考生與考官面對面的交流的過程,考官根據考生的綜合表現來打分。那是不是就是說這個分數就完全憑考官喜好來打分呢?當然不是,公務員面試根據考察考生的各項能力是否符合所報職位來打分,那麼,公務員考試面試都考察什麼?1、綜合分析...
-
面試早到了,能做些什麼事
面試者:早到是否萬無一失?HR容忍度:有波動有人糊塗也有人謹慎,對於時間觀念比較強的求職者來說,會給自己預留出一些時間來預防遲到。於是就引發了下面一串疑問:如果面試者早到了,是否可以提前進行面試?HR是否介意麵試者早到公司?面試早到了,能做些什麼?早到時,哪些“佛腳”...
-
面試,這些問題一定要問清楚!
現如今,找一份工作實屬不易,尤其是剛畢業的大學生,他們在求職之初就更不敢多與企業談條件了。為了得到工作機會,部分大學生最初與企業面談的時候,不敢多提要求,往往是企業方一錘定音;可是一旦入職後才發現工作的種種問題,似乎並非自己想象的那樣,然後就進入了接二連三的...
-
面試,是一個面對面交流的過程
為什麼每次面試後,讓我回去等通知,就沒有任何下文了呢?每年求職季,都會有很多求職者發出這樣的疑問?但覆盤自己面試的過程,又覺得沒什麼問題,態度良好,該回答的都回答上了。所以,到底是哪出問題了呢? 面試,是一個面對面交流的過程,其中可能一些細節或者行為都在無意間...